witorwitor Posted - 22/11/2024 : 01:40:08
If the middle of the large AAT sector is let's say straight north from the start and someone flies north-west, LK keeps showing the optimized target near the middle of the sector rather than on the west side of the sector. If someone flew to this 'optimized' target they would end up with a large detour as they would end up flying in an arc, first northwest and then northeast to get to the 'optimized' target.

If one carries on flying northwest, as soon as one enters the sector on the west site then suddenly the optimized target jumps west to the point where it should have been long before sector was entered!

Optimisation does not seem to take into account the track already flown before the sector is entered. Any chance this could be improved in future updates?
